Things to do in Easton?
Easton is a small town located in Bristol County, Massachusetts. With a population of around 22,000 people, this charming community features historical sites such as the Ames Free Library and Oliver House Museum along with various recreational activities such as golf courses, walking/biking trails, and parks for visitors to explore. Easton is also home to numerous shops, restaurants, and other attractions that make it the perfect destination for a day trip or longer vacation.
Things to do in St. Bonaventure?
Living in St. Bonaventure, NY can be a truly rewarding experience. This small village of just over 5,000 people is situated in the heart of the beautiful Allegheny Mountains and provides a picturesque backdrop for any outdoor activity. The community is very close knit, with warm and welcoming citizens that are always happy to help out their neighbors. There is a wide range of activities available for all ages, from hiking and fishing to attending local festivals and events throughout the year. With its stunning scenery, friendly people, and ample recreational opportunities, St. Bonaventure is a wonderful place to call home!
